Commercial Invoice Attestation For UAE Requirements
Commercial invoice attestation is often required for official trade, export, import, customs, and chamber of commerce documentation in the UAE. The process typically involves several verification steps, depending on the country of origin or destination and the nature of the transaction. TrustaQ assists by first checking your invoice details, confirming the issuing company information, understanding the specific destination country's requirements, and clarifying the trade purpose. This initial review helps determine the correct attestation route.
The attestation journey for a commercial invoice may include steps with a Chamber of Commerce, relevant Ministries, the Embassy or Consulate of the destination country, and potentially the UAE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MOFA). Documents Commonly Required
Original Commercial Invoice
Copy of the company's Trade License
Copy of the signatory's Passport
Authorization letter (if a representative is submitting)
Bill of Lading or Airway Bill (if applicable)

What is commercial invoice attestation?
Commercial invoice attestation is the official verification process of a commercial invoice by various authorities, such as a Chamber of Commerce, Ministry of Foreign Affairs, or relevant Embassy. This process confirms the authenticity of the document for international trade, customs, and legal purposes.
